This book provides comprehensive answer reader a clear view of the entire process, explains the ins and outs of shipping and insurance costs, currency exchange, dealing with banks, contracts, customs and transportation. Completely revised and use of which 140 model contracts, documents and ready-to-forms, export / import procedures and documentation up-to-the-minute information includes new security procedures, the movement to Internet-based documentation, which recently adopt free trade, increased compliance measures under the Consumer Products Safety Commission. Written in clear, everyday language and gives with checklists, questionnaires and a glossary of international terms of trade of these trusted source of import / export professionals everything they need to do the job.
